Checking Driver's Door Power Window Operation: EuroVan
- Ensure power windows are mechanically okay. Ensure battery is fully charged. Check fuse No. 14 (10-amp) located in fuse/relay panel. Check circuit breaker S43 (30-amp) located above fuse/relay panel. Repair as necessary.
- Turn ignition off. Remove left door window regulator switch from driver's door trim panel. Check left front window switch continuity between switch terminals No. 4 (Green/White wire) and No. 1 (Red wire) with switch in window up position. Check switch continuity between terminals No. 4 (Green/White wire) and No. 2 (Brown wire) with switch in window down position. See WIRING DIAGRAMS . If continuity exists, go to next step. If continuity does not exist, replace switch.
- Turn ignition off. Disconnect left power window control module connector. Turn ignition on. Measure voltage between control module connector terminals No. 6 (Brown wire) and No. 10 (Red wire). If approximately zero volts is present, go to next step. If battery voltage is present, go to step 5 .
- Check for continuity between ground and control module connector terminal No. 6 (Brown wire). If continuity does not exist, repair Brown wire between control module and ground connection. If continuity exists, check Red wire between window control module and relay panel connector terminal No. 30. See WIRING DIAGRAMS . Repair as necessary. If Red wire is okay, replace relay panel.
- Turn ignition off. Remove driver's door trim panel. Disconnect left front power window regulator 5-pin connector. Disconnect left front power window control module 14-pin connector. Check for continuity between specified window regulator and power window control module connector terminals. See CHECKING LEFT FRONT WINDOW REGULATOR-TO-POWER WINDOW CONTROL MODULE WIRING HARNESS
table. See WIRING DIAGRAMS
. If continuity exists, go to next step. If continuity does not exist, repair circuit as necessary.CHECKING LEFT FRONT WINDOW REGULATOR-TO-POWER WINDOW CONTROL MODULE WIRING HARNESS
Left Front Window Regulator Switch Connector Terminal No. (Wire Color) (1) Left Front Power Window Control Module Connector Terminal No. (Wire Color) (2) 1 (RED) 14 (RED) 3 (BLK) 7 (BLK) 4 (GRN/WHT) 13 (GRN/WHT) (1) Connect DVOM Red positive lead to power window regulator switch connector terminal. (2) Connect DVOM Black negative lead to power window control module connector terminal. - Check for continuity between ground and left front power window regulator 5-pin connector terminal No. 2 (Brown wire). If continuity exists, go to next step. If continuity does not exist, repair Brown wire between window regulator and ground connection.
- Measure voltage between left front power window control module 14-pin connector terminal No. 2 (Black/Blue wire) and No. 6 (Brown wire). Turn ignition on. If battery voltage is present, go to next step. If battery voltage is not present, check Black/Blue wire circuit between control module and relay panel terminal No. 15. See WIRING DIAGRAMS . Repair as necessary. If Black/Blue wire circuit is okay, replace window control module.
- Open driver's door (ensure door contact switch is closed). Check for continuity between ground and left front power window control module 14-pin connector terminal No. 5 (Brown/White wire). If continuity exists, go to next step. If continuity does not exist, check Brown/White wire between control module connector and door contact switch. If Brown/White wire is okay, replace door contact switch.
- With driver's door open, press door contact switch (ensure door contact switch is open). Check for continuity between ground and left front power window control module 14-pin connector terminal No. 5 (Brown/White wire). If continuity exists, replace door contact switch. If continuity does not exist, replace combined motor and left power window control module.
